About

This Claude Skill provides a systematic four-phase heuristic (understand, plan, execute, review) for solving novel mathematical, logical, and engineering problems requiring invention. It is specifically designed for discovery-based challenges, not for rote calculations or applying memorized procedures. Developers should use it to guide Claude through exploratory problem-solving where the solution path is not immediately known.
